Cracked foundation repair services involve assessing and addressing damage to the structural base of a building caused by various factors such as soil movement, moisture changes, or settling. These services typically include the evaluation of foundation issues, followed by the implementation of stabilization techniques. Common methods may involve underpinning, piering, or slab jacking to restore stability and prevent further deterioration. The goal is to reinforce the foundation to support the building’s weight and maintain its structural integrity.

Foundation problems often manifest as vis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, sticking doors or windows, and in some cases, noticeable shifts in the structure’s alignment. Left unaddressed, these issues can lead to more severe damage, including compromised load-bearing capacity and increased repair costs. Cracked foundation repair services aim to identify the root causes of these issues and provide solutions that prevent further movement or settling, helping to preserve the safety and value of the property.

These repair services are commonly utilized for residential properties such as single-family homes, townhouses, and multi-unit dwellings. Commercial buildings, including retail centers, office complexes, and industrial facilities, may also require foundation stabilization if settling or cracking occurs. Properties built on expansive or unstable soils are particularly susceptible to foundation issues, making professional assessment and repair essential for maintaining the building’s longevity and safety.

Typical costs for cracked foundation repair range from approximately $2,000 to $7,000 depending on the severity of the damage and the repair method used. Minor cracks may cost around $1,000 to $3,000, while extensive foundation work can exceed $10,000. Costs vary based on local conditions and contractor pricing.

Foundation crack repair expenses generally fall between $500 and $3,000 for small to medium cracks. Larger or more complex cracks, especially those requiring underpinning or stabilization, can increase costs significantly.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ific foundation conditions.

Cost factors for foundation stabilization include the extent of the damage, the repair techniques chosen, and the foundation type. On average, stabilization services may cost from $3,000 to $15,000, with some projects exceeding this range for extensive repairs. Prices vary across different regions and providers.

Average costs for foundation leveling typically range from $4,000 to $10,000. Minor adjustments or slab jacking tend to be at the lower end of the spectrum, while full foundation lifts or underpinning can be more costly. What are common signs of a cracked foundation?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, doors or windows that stick, and gaps around window frames.

How do professionals typically repair a cracked foundation? Repair methods may involve epoxy injections, foundation underpinning, or wall stabilization, depending on the severity and type of cracks.

Is foundation cracking always a serious issue? Not all cracks indicate severe problems; some may be minor and caused by settling or temperature changes. A professional assessment can determine the significance.

How long does foundation repair usually take? The duration varies based on the extent of damage and repair method, but most proj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
